Output e109ac9ab2ae44c63b6f7b0696d8ced002a157bc5596163c2f262c242cf9eba5:0

value
846257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3b88b63f5eeff12bd539330dca289fa4cc274c4 OP_EQUAL
address
3J5HxFtwR9wmbh33WznWbKN8BarASQJvQs
transaction
e109ac9ab2ae44c63b6f7b0696d8ced002a157bc5596163c2f262c242cf9eba5
confirmations
304616
spent
true